805.2 (B) Compositional Arrangement
A choreographic work “represents a related series of dance movements and patterns” organized into an integrated, coherent, and expressive compositional whole. Horgan, 789 F.2d at 161 (quoting COMPENDIUM (SECOND) § 450.03 (A)).
As discussed in Section 805.5 (B) (3), non-expressive physical movements, such as ordinary motor activities, functional physical activities, competitive maneuvers, and the like are not registrable as choreographic works. Likewise, de minimis dance steps and movements are not protectable, because they do not contain a sufficient amount of choreographic authorship. See Section 805.5 (A).
